Creating a design
Step 1: Start creation
Click the "Create design" button to open the initial configuration modal.
Step 2: Configure name and format
Design name: For internal reference only. Helps you identify the design later (e.g., "Theater Design 2024", "Tickets with Coca-Cola Sponsor"). Not displayed anywhere.
Format: Choose the ticket size:
| Format | Dimensions | Ideal for |
|---|---|---|
| Roll | 176 × 329 mm | Online tickets, large centered QR, vertical design |
| Card | 467 × 141 mm | Premium card-style tickets, large concerts, horizontal design |
| Custom | Customizable | Define exact width and height in pixels for specific needs |
Step 3: Choose starting point
You have two options:
- Create from scratch — Start with an empty canvas
- Use a template — Pre-designed Fanz templates (one for Roll, one for Card) that you can modify
Tip: If it's your first design, we recommend using a template and modifying it. You'll learn the builder faster.
The ticket builder
When you choose to create or use a template, the visual builder opens. Here you'll design your ticket by dragging blocks and seeing results in real-time.
General view
- Center: Canvas in the size you chose. Here you see the ticket and can add, move, and resize blocks
- Top bar: Navigation and action controls
- Right sidebar: Add blocks and view element list
Top bar (Navbar)
Left side
- X (close) — Closes the builder (asks if you want to save)
- Ticket name — The name you gave the design
- Format — Shows the selected size
Right side
- Undo / Redo — Buttons to undo or redo any action
- Settings — Opens the general ticket configuration modal
- Preview — Generates a real PDF to see how it looks (you can download it)
- Save and close — Saves the design and returns to the listing
General settings
When clicking Settings, a modal opens with:
Ticket size
You can edit the ticket width and height at any time.
Background color
Choose a background color using the color picker.
Background image
Upload an image that fills the entire ticket. Very useful if you designed something in Canva or Photoshop and want to use it as a base.
Image fit options:
| Option | Behavior |
|---|---|
| Cover | Fills the entire ticket, may crop edges |
| Contain | Shows the full image, may leave space around |
| Fill | Stretches to fill, may distort |
When done, click Save changes or Cancel to discard.

Right sidebar
Adding blocks
Click "Add block" to see available options:
| Block type | Description |
|---|---|
| Dynamic text | Fields that auto-fill with event/purchase data |
| Static text | Fixed text that you write |
| Image | Brand logo, event banner, or custom image |
| QR code | The QR to validate the ticket at the door |
| Shapes | Lines, rectangles, circles, triangles, stars |
Block list
Below the add button, you see the list of all blocks on the canvas with their name and coordinates. Click any item to select it on the canvas.
Block types in detail
Dynamic text
Fields that auto-fill with real data:
| Field | Example |
|---|---|
| Ticket name | "General Admission" |
| Seat number | "A-15" |
| Ticket price | "$50.00" |
| Ticket rate | "Early Bird" |
| Event title | "Rock Concert" |
| Event date | "December 25, 2024" |
| Event time | "9:00 PM" |
| Location | "Madison Square Garden" |
| Address | "4 Pennsylvania Plaza" |
| User name | "John Smith" |
| Assistant name | "Jane Doe" |
| User email | "john@email.com" |
| User ID | "12345678" |
| Purchase ID | "PUR-123456" |
| Purchase date | "December 20, 2024" |
Additional options:
- Prefix: Text before the field (e.g., "Seat: ")
- Suffix: Text after the field (e.g., " USD")
Available styles:
- Font size
- Text color
- Font: Helvetica, Helvetica Bold, Times, Courier
- Alignment: Left, Center, Right
Static text
Fixed text that you write. Same style options as dynamic text.
Common uses:
- Access instructions
- Parking information
- Event hashtags
- Sponsor acknowledgments
- Legal text or terms
Image
Image source:
| Option | Description |
|---|---|
| Brand logo | Automatically taken from your branding settings |
| Event banner | Automatically taken from the event |
| Custom image | Upload any image (sponsor logos, etc.) |
Image fit: Contain, Cover, Fill (same as background image)
QR code
The QR code to validate the ticket at the door.
Important: You can only add one QR code per design. It has no customization options—it's added directly to the canvas.
Shapes
Decorative elements for your design:
| Shape | Options |
|---|---|
| Rectangle | Fill color, border color, border width |
| Circle | Fill color, border color, border width |
| Triangle | Fill color, border color, border width |
| Star | Fill color, border color, border width |
| Line | Fill color, border color, border width |
Working with blocks on the canvas
Selecting a block
Click any block on the canvas to select it. A blue frame appears around it.
Moving a block
With the block selected, click and drag to move it to the desired position.
Resizing a block
Drag the corners of the blue frame to change the size.
Editing properties
- Double-click on the block, or
- Click the Edit button that appears when selected
The properties modal opens where you can modify everything.
Available actions
| Action | Description |
|---|---|
| Edit | Opens the properties modal (not available for QR) |
| Duplicate | Creates an exact copy of the block (not available for QR) |
| Delete | Removes the block from the canvas |
Saving and managing designs
Saving the design
Click "Save and close" to save your work and return to the creation modal. From there, click "Create design" to finish.
Designs table
Your designs appear in a table with:
| Column | Description |
|---|---|
| Name | Design name |
| Format | Vertical, Horizontal, or Custom |
| Block count | How many elements it has |
| Default | ⭐ if it's the default design |
| Creation date | When it was created |
| Actions | Menu with more options |
Available actions
- Edit — Opens the builder to modify the design
- Set as default — This design will be used automatically for all new events
- Duplicate — Creates a copy of the design
- Delete — Permanently removes the design
Note: If you delete a design that's assigned to tickets, those tickets will use Fanz's default design instead.
Assigning design to tickets
Designs are assigned per ticket, not per event. This allows you to have different designs for different ticket types within the same event (for example, one design for VIP and another for General).
Note: The option to select a ticket design only appears if you have at least one design created. If you don't see this option, it's because you haven't created any custom designs yet.
Option 1: During event creation
When you're creating an event and reach the create tickets step:
- When creating the first ticket, select the design you want to use
- All tickets you add after will have that same design as default
- You can change each ticket's design individually if you want to use different designs
Option 2: After creating the event
If you've already created the event and want to change a ticket's design:
- Go to Events and select the event
- Navigate to the Tickets tab
- Find the ticket you want to modify and click the 3 dots (options menu)
- Select Edit
- Choose the ticket design you want to use
- You can click Preview to see how it looks with that specific ticket's data
- You can also download the PDF to view or print it
Tip: The design marked as default in your designs list is automatically selected when you create new tickets.
